  • The stock is up 8.4% year to date and 8.6% over the last 12 months, but that ride has been choppy, with a 3.4% dip in the last week and only a modest 1.2% gain over the past month, which tells you sentiment is still undecided.
  • Recent moves have been driven less by company specific headlines and more by shifting expectations around offshore drilling demand, day-rate trends and oil price volatility. As investors rotate in and out of energy names, Transocean keeps getting repriced as the market rethinks how durable offshore spending really is.
